In “The Great Gatsby,” F. Scott Fitzgerald explores the American Dream’s corruption through the life of Jay Gatsby, a self-made millionaire obsessed with reclaiming his lost love, Daisy Buchanan. Set in the Roaring Twenties, the novel portrays themes of wealth, class, and idealism. Gatsby’s lavish parties and mysterious past symbolize both the allure and emptiness of materialism. Despite his immense wealth, Gatsby fails to win Daisy, who remains tied to her husband, Tom Buchanan. The story, narrated by Nick Carraway, critiques the moral decay and social stratification of the era, culminating in tragedy as Gatsby’s dreams unravel, exposing the futility of his pursuit.
